Transaction 3a39e248c521633bb0e8f17b1ffa2531725e05a95e8d375b08c6859e8e61fe20
1 Input
1 Output
-
3a39e248c521633bb0e8f17b1ffa2531725e05a95e8d375b08c6859e8e61fe20:0
- value
- 14980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1d8f1434927403c1aa25dc6a50d7438097c39a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P3mjf2XkxarFVT3jQvMHqRhFvN8dDfwgP